Reports say Samsung is laying off workers in the US. An employee shared this on Reddit, saying the company is letting go of staff without warning, and it's affecting whole teams of people who have worked there for a long time. Some employees were on business trips when they found out, and their company cards were suddenly stopped, leaving them stranded.
It's not clear how many people are being laid off, but people online think it might be connected to Samsung's plan from 2023 to cut staff by up to 30% in some areas.
Many people are upset about workers being let go while they're traveling or on leave. Some have even mentioned similar things happening at other companies. Samsung hasn't said anything about these claims yet.
